Lord of the Rings Blu-ray Date and Details

June 26, 2009

The details are starting to fill in on the much-anticipated The Lord of the Rings Blu-ray box set from New Line and Warner Home Video.

First, we can now confirm via retailers and a trade magazine advertisement that the finalized release date for the set is November 3. That is about a month earlier than initially expected so good news on that front.

As you may already know, this box set is strictly the theatrical versions of each film: The Fellowship of the Ring, The Two Towers, and Return of the King. The extended cuts previously released on DVD are being held back for a separate box set release expected to time with Guillermo del Toro's first The Hobbit film's theatrical or home video release.

Bonus features for this first LOTR Blu-ray set have also been revealed and, as expected, contain no new material. The newness will come from the 1080p video and lossless audio (exact format unknown but 7.1 DTS-HD Master Audio is expected) which is what most of you are clamoring for anyways.
